Supply Chain Industry Experiences Rapid Development of Zero-Emitting Vehicles and Freight Trucks
Environmental Defense Fund (EDF)
In the United States, electric vehicle sales grew 4% while overall car sales decreased 15%, while in Europe, electric vehicle sales increased 135% while overall car sales decreased 24%. Overall, global electric vehicle sales increased 46%.

How Propane Can Reduce a Port’s Environmental Impact
Propane Education & Research Council (PERC)
Propane can be used in a wide variety of port applications, including port and terminal tractors, forklifts, light- and medium-duty vehicles, shuttles and even small marine vessels.
